Each of the attendants appointed by the justices of the appellate division of the fourth department shall receive a compensation of three thousand four hundred fifty dollars per year, payable monthly. Each of the attendants appointed by the justices of the appellate division of the third department shall receive a compensation to be fixed by said justices at not to exceed three thousand four hundred fifty dollars per year, payable monthly. Such attendants shall also be entitled to receive their traveling expenses to and from their homes to the place where said sessions are held, not exceeding once in each term. The compensation of the attendants shall be paid by the department of taxation and finance upon the certificate of the presiding justice of the department.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- New York Consolidated Laws, Judiciary Law - JUD § 345. Compensation of attendants of appellate division in third and fourth departments - last updated January 01, 2026 | https://codes.findlaw.com/ny/judiciary-law/jud-sect-345/
